Technical Anatomy of a Digital Wallet

At their core, digital wallets are software applications designed to securely store private keys and facilitate transactions. They can be categorized as hardware wallets, desktop applications, mobile apps, or web-based interfaces. The functionality of a digital wallet hinges on various interconnected components, including:

  • Backend Infrastructure: Servers that communicate with blockchain networks.
  • Client-Side Interface: User-facing applications providing dashboards and transaction tools.
  • Security Layers: Encryption, multi-factor authentication, and secure key storage mechanisms.
  • Network Protocols: APIs and P2P modules facilitating connectivity with various blockchains.

Deep Industry Insights: Ensuring Robustness in Cryptocurrency Wallets

Serious platform developers prioritise several strategies to mitigate these issues and improve overall reliability:

  • Decentralisation of Infrastructure: Reducing single points of failure by leveraging multiple servers and distributed nodes.
  • Layered Security Protocols: Implementing multi-factor authentication and hardware security modules (HSMs) to protect private keys.
  • Real-Time Network Monitoring: Using sophisticated tools and analytics to detect and resolve outages swiftly.
  • User Education: Providing transparent guides on troubleshooting and transaction management.
